I started out die cutting a piece of Neenah Solar White card stock using the Large Rectangle from the Blueprints #29 Die-namics set and then I die cut the new Starry Circle Die-namic from the center as well. I added some color to the circle panel with some Faded Jeans and Chipped Sapphire Distress Inks. Then I stamped the sentiment in the lower corner of the panel and adhered it to a card front. I inlaid the starry die cut back into the center. All of the little star die cuts from the center die I added some Spectrum Noir Sparkle Pen and inlaid them back into the center image.

mp11

I stamped the reindeer images from the Merry Everything set using some Memento Tuxedo Black ink and I colored the images in with Copics. Then I cut the images out using the coordinating die cuts. I adhered the images over the Starry Center using some Scotch foam tape. For a bit more Sparkle I added some of the Sparkle Pen to the ornaments and the Scarves on the deer.

mp22

I used the following Copics to color the images:

 E31, E34, E35, E37 & E29 / G28, G07 & Yg17 / C3, C1 & C0 / Y13 & Y15 / R24, R27 & R29 / R30 / B26, B24 & B23

I started out by adding some Spun Sugar Distress ink to a piece of Neenah Solar White card stock and then I die cut two cloud borders and a cloud using the Avery Elle Pierced Cloud die set. Then I stamped the unicorn image onto some Neenah Solar White using Memento Tuxedo Black ink and colored it in with Copics. I fussy cut the unicorn our and added some Black marker around the edge to make the cut look cleaner. I stamped the sentiment onto one of the cloud borders using the Mini Misti tool and a few of the stars from the stamp set. I assembled the image panel using some Foam tape and colored in the stars with Copics as well.

mp1

Then I die cut the smallest of the new Postage Stamp dies from Avery Elle from some Licorice card stock from Lawn Fawn. And I adhered the frame over the image panel with some additional foam tape and liquid glue. I created a top folding A2 size White card base and adhered the image panel with some liquid glue. For some Sparkle I added some Clear Wink of Stella to the Unicorn image and the Stars. I also added some Stickles glitter to the edges of the clouds. And I had to add some Sparkling Clear Mix Sequins from Pretty Pink Posh for some extra Shine!

I started by created a fun Distress Ink background on a piece of Tim Holtz Watercolor card stock that I die cut with the Wonky Stitched Rectangle dies from My Favorite things. I heat embossed the stars cluster image from the Spooky Sweets set using some WOW White embossing powder.  (P.S. We are carrying  WOW embossing powders in the store now.. there are so many Gorgeous Colors!) Then I “smooched” some Mustard Seed Distress ink onto the background.

mp2

I stamped the Pumpkins with Lawn Fawn inks in Carrot, Fake Tan and Pumpkin Spice. I layered each color to create the shading. The bats are stamped in VersaFine Black Onyx ink on some Neenah Solar White card stock. The images are die cut with the coordinating dies and then I adhered them to the distressed panel with liquid glue and foam tape. I stamped the sentiment onto a banner die cut from the MFT Blueprints 27 die set. I created a top folding White card base and added an offset panel of Black Licorice card stock cut with the same size Wonky Stitched die. Then I added the image panel and some Sparkling Clear Sequins from the Pretty Pink Posh mix.

I started out by die cutting three panels from some White Card stock using the STAX Cross Stitched Rectangle Dies from Lawn Fawn and I also cut a piece of the Plaid paper with the Cross Stitched Rectangles as well. I created a White card base and added the Pattern paper. Then from two of the panels, I die cut the Stitched Mountain Border from Lawn Fawn and then Stitched Hillside Borders. From the third panel I die cut the Avery Elle Falling Snow die after I applied some Peacock Feathers Distress Ink. I added some additional Peacock Feathers ink to the hillside pieces and the mountain caps.

mp2

I stamped the Winter Unicorn image onto some Neenah Solar White card stock in Memento Tuxedo Black ink and then I colored it in with Copic Markers. Hair: BG10, BG11 & BG13 Body: C00, C01, C02 & C05 Cheeks: R20 Horn: Y00 & Y02 Scarf: R02 & R05. Then I die cut the unicorn using the coordinating Die and I added some Clear Sparkle Pen from Spectrum Noir.

mp1

I stamped the sentiment using the Mini Misti onto the lower corner of the Hillside piece with some Storm Cloud ink from Lawn Fawn. And then I assembled the scene and adhered it to the front of the card. I added the Unicorn image with some foam tape. On the inside of the card I stamped the other sentiments from the set to say  ” you! and a unicorn”. I also added a few little hearts from some other Lawn Fawn sets in Guava Ink.
